A: The dimensions 20x42x12 refer to a bearing's inner diameter (20 mm), outer diameter (42 mm), and width (12 mm). These measurements ensure compatibility with specific machinery or applications.
A: Ball bearings (20x42x12) use spherical rolling elements for lower friction in high-speed applications, while roller bearings employ cylindrical rollers to handle heavier radial loads but at lower speeds.
A: A 20x42x12 bearing is often used in small motors, pumps, or industrial equipment requiring compact sizing and moderate load capacity. Its design suits both radial and axial load scenarios.
A: Ensure shafts and housings are clean, aligned, and lubricated. Use specialized tools to press-fit the bearing evenly, avoiding direct hammer strikes to prevent damage to races or seals.
A: No, ball and roller bearings with 20x42x12 dimensions have distinct internal designs and load capacities. Always verify the bearing type (e.g., deep groove ball or cylindrical roller) before replacement.
